Soundproof window replacement services involve swapping out existing windows with specially designed, sound-insulating alternatives. These windows are built with multiple panes, thicker glass, and advanced sealing techniques to significantly reduce the amount of noise that enters a property. The process typically includes removing old windows, preparing the window openings for the new units, and installing the soundproof windows to ensure a tight fit. This upgrade can help create a quieter indoor environment, making it easier to relax, work, or sleep without disturbance from outside noise.
Many common problems can be alleviated with soundproof window replacement. Homes located near busy streets, highways, or commercial areas often struggle with constant traffic noise that disrupts daily life. In addition, properties near airports, train stations, or industrial zones may experience elevated noise levels that interfere with rest and concentration. Older windows with single or double glazing may also be less effective at blocking sound, leading to a persistent noise intrusion. Replacing these windows with soundproof models can dramatically improve indoor comfort and reduce the need for additional noise control measures.

The overview below groups typical Soundproof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Jasper, IN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or soundproof window replacements or upgrades,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, covering standard window sizes and simple installations.
Partial Window Replacement - When replacing several windows or larger units, costs generally range from $600 to $1,500 per window. Projects of this size are common for homeowners seeking improved noise reduction across multiple rooms.
Full Window Replacement - Complete replacement of all windows in a home can cost between $3,000 and $8,000, depending on the number and size of windows. Larger, more complex projects tend to push costs into the higher end of this range.
Custom or High-End Installations - Premium soundproof windows or custom designs for unique properties can exceed $10,000. Such projects are less frequent but are chosen for specialized noise reduction needs or luxury renovations.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do soundproof window replacements differ from standard window upgrades? Soundproof window replacements typically involve specialized glass and framing materials designed to minimize sound transmission, unlike standard windows which may not provide significant noise reduction.
Can soundproof window replacement help with external noise from traffic or neighbors? Yes, upgrading to soundproof windows can significantly decrease external noise, making indoor spaces quieter and more peaceful.
Are there different types of soundproof windows available through local contractors? Yes, local service providers often offer various options, including laminated glass and double or triple-pane designs, to suit different soundproofing needs.
